The Importance of Auxiliary Slurry Pump Factories in Industrial Applications
In today's industrial landscape, the efficient transfer of fluids, particularly slurries, is crucial for the seamless operation of various processes. At the heart of this function lies the auxiliary slurry pump, a specialized device designed to handle the complex task of moving dense mixtures of solids and liquids. The manufacturing of these pumps is typically carried out in dedicated factories that specialize in producing high-quality auxiliary slurry pumps capable of meeting diverse industrial needs.
Auxiliary slurry pumps are integral to numerous sectors, including mining, construction, wastewater treatment, and manufacturing. Unlike standard pumps, slurry pumps are engineered to transport thick, abrasive mixtures, which present unique challenges due to their viscosity and solid content. As such, the design and construction of these pumps require a careful selection of materials and innovative engineering solutions to ensure durability and efficiency.

Quality control is another essential aspect of the manufacturing process. Each pump must undergo rigorous testing to ensure it meets industry standards and performance expectations. Tests often include pressure tests, flow rate evaluations, and operational trials under different conditions. These evaluations help identify any potential weaknesses in the design or materials, allowing manufacturers to make necessary adjustments before the pumps are deployed in the field.
